Kel-Tec RFB headlines the specification sheet for this platform. Factory chambered in 308 Win,7.62 NATO, built around a semi-auto action with a 20+1 round capacity to keep performance predictable from shot to shot. Dimensional notes call out a barrel length of 24" in and overall length measuring 31" in, helping you plan cases and storage. Unloaded weight settles near 9.80 lbs, which influences recoil management and carry options. Twist rate is listed at 1:11.25 RH, offering guidance on which projectile weights stabilize best. Furniture is trimmed in zytel with a black finish, giving the rifle its classic profile. Metalwork wears a black/tan cerakote treatment, pairing durability with period-correct styling.
